What Information Does the Roster Provide?

The Randolph County Jail roster typically includes several key pieces of information about each inmate. This usually includes:

  • Inmate Full Name: The complete name of the person in custody.
  • Booking Date: The date when the individual was booked into the jail.
  • Charges: A list of the criminal charges for which the person was arrested.
  • Bond Amount: The amount of money required for the inmate to be released from custody.
  • Mugshot: A photograph taken at the time of booking.
  • Other identifying information: This might include age, race, gender, and address.

The availability of each piece of information can vary, but generally, the roster provides enough detail to confirm whether a specific person is currently incarcerated in the Randolph County Jail. How to Access the Randolph County Jail Roster

Okay, so how do you actually get your hands on this roster? The Randolph County Sheriff's Office typically provides the jail roster through their official website. Accessing it is usually pretty straightforward. Here’s what you generally need to do:

  1. Go to the Randolph County Sheriff's Office Website: Just search for "Randolph County Sheriff's Office" on Google, and you should find their official website.
  2. Look for a Jail Roster or Inmate Search Link: The website might have a specific section dedicated to jail information. Look for links like "Jail Roster," "Inmate Search," or something similar.
  3. Follow the Instructions: Once you find the right page, there will likely be a search interface where you can enter the inmate's name or other identifying information.
  4. Review the Results: If the person is currently in custody, their information should appear in the search results. If you don't find them, double-check the spelling and try different search terms.

Sometimes, the roster might be available as a downloadable PDF document. In other cases, it might be an interactive database that you can search directly on the website. If you're having trouble finding the roster online, you can always try contacting the Randolph County Sheriff's Office directly by phone or in person. Contacting the Jail Directly

If you're unable to find the information you need online, you can always contact the Randolph County Jail directly. The jail staff can provide you with information about inmates currently in custody, as well as answer any questions you may have. You can usually find the jail's contact information on the Randolph County Sheriff's Office website.

When you call, be prepared to provide as much information as possible about the inmate you're looking for, such as their full name, date of birth, and any other identifying information you may have. The more information you can provide, the easier it will be for the jail staff to assist you.
